Acciona Energía Divests Hydro Assets for €287 Million

Acciona Energía has agreed to sell its hydroelectric group, Acciona Saltos de Agua, S.L., to Elawan Energy for €287 million, expecting a closure by year’s end and a capital gain of about €170 million. The deal includes 23 hydroelectric power stations totaling 175MW across Spain, signifying a strategic asset rotation for Acciona and a bolstering of Elawan’s renewable energy portfolio. This sale represents 20% of Acciona Energía’s hydraulic capacity and underscores the value of the company’s energy assets.
